Steyr 6100/6200 CVT
AdBlue (DEF) capacity & service interval
The Steyr 6100/6200 CVT uses AdBlue (DEF) fluid with a capacity of 56 liters. The data covers 7 configurations of this model.

Additional Notes
- All seven variants of the Steyr 6100/6200 CVT series share an identical AdBlue (DEF) tank capacity of 56 liters, applying uniformly across the 6150, 6165, 6175, 6185, 6200, 6220, and 6240 CVT configurations under normal use conditions.
- A 56-liter AdBlue reservoir is a relatively large tank capacity for agricultural machinery, reflecting the extended operational cycles typical of high-horsepower tractors where frequent refilling would interrupt field work.
- AdBlue, also known as Diesel Exhaust Fluid (DEF), is a urea-water solution consumed by the selective catalytic reduction (SCR) system to reduce nitrogen oxide (NOx) emissions in diesel engines. The 56-liter figure represents the total fluid storage capacity of the onboard tank, not a dosing rate or refill interval.
- The SCR system noted across all rows is an emissions control technology that injects AdBlue into the exhaust stream upstream of a catalytic converter, converting NOx into nitrogen and water vapor. Tank capacity directly influences how long the machine can operate before an AdBlue refill is required.
- The 6150, 6165, and 6175 CVT variants carry a starting year of 2015, while the 6185, 6200, 6220, and 6240 CVT variants carry a starting year of 2016, representing a staggered introduction across the model range.
- Despite the difference in introduction years between the 2015 and 2016 variants, the AdBlue tank capacity of 56 liters remains consistent across both groups, indicating a standardized fluid system architecture across the entire CVT lineup.
